Prerequisites
The TIBCO Data Virtualization Container distribution comes with a Helm chart to simplify the deployment of TDV. This section describes all the prerequisites you need before deploying a TDV application.
1. Ensure that your Kubernetes cluster version (i.e. server version) is 1.21 (or later), helm client is version 3.4 (or later), and any OCI compliant container runtime supported by Kubernetes:

TDV uses Docker for development/testing of the TDV container images.
2. Refer to Sizing Guidelines for TDV for sizing recommendations and accordingly choose your environment.
3. You will need a container registry url, username and password that can be accessible by your Kubernetes cluster to retrieve the TDV container image. It is required to pre-build the TDV container image for this distribution before you deploy any TDV applications.
